Identity is a set of claims about a person, place or thing. This usually comprises of first and last name, birth date, nationality, and some form of national identity for people, such as passport number, phone number (SSN), driving license, etc. These data points are issued and stored in centralized databases (central government servers) by centralized bodies (governments). For different purposes, physical forms of identification are not easily obtainable to every human being. Approximately 1.1 billion individuals around the world have no means of claiming possession of their identity. This leaves one seventh of the world's population unable to vote in elections, own land, open a bank account, or find jobs in a fragile state. The failure to obtain identity documents jeopardizes the access of an individual to the financial system and in turn, restricts their rights People with officially recognised identification types continue to lack full ownership. They have a fragmented experience of online identity and unknowingly miss the importance that their details creates. We can store identity on a decentralized network by using block chain technology. We can develop an application that offers access so that users can store their information and avoid data tampering, and we will also provide access to the individual who needs our information.
